When I Lived in Modern Times, by Linda Grant, Plume, 272 pp.

August 15, 2011

Linda Grant’s When I Lived in Modern Times is an informative, well-written, and engrossing narrative set in Palestine in 1946. The narrator is a young woman, Evelyn Sert, who is on a journey that takes her to one of the most conflicted regions and times in modern history. It’s an inspiring read for historical-fiction lovers and a most recommended read for those who love a good story.
